To solve the question regarding the assertion and reason, we will analyze both statements step by step. ### Step 1: Analyze the Assertion - **Assertion (A)**: "Haploid cells are formed by meiosis cell division." - Meiosis is a type of cell division that reduces the chromosome number by half. It is specifically responsible for producing gametes (sperm and egg cells) in organisms. - In humans, for example, diploid cells (which have two sets of chromosomes) undergo meiosis to produce haploid cells (which have one set of chromosomes). - Therefore, the assertion is **true**. ...
